摘  要:为了评价近海海水和沉积物中重金属含量与分布,以海南陵水新村港为例,对新村港近海区域设置取样监测点,分析海水和表层沉积物中的重金属元素(Cd、Pb、As、Cu、Hg和Zn)含量,采用综合污染指数法和潜在生态风险指数法对海水和沉积物中的重金属污染程度与生态风险进行了评价。结果表明,海水中Cd、Pb、As、Cu和Zn的含量(μg/L)范围分别为0~0.58μg/L、0~3.85μg/L、0.6~4.15μg/L、0.55~4.7μg/L和0~48μg/L,年均含量分别为0.073μg/L、0.87μg/L、1.67μg/L、1.90μg/L和14.49μg/L,Hg未检出。表层沉积物Cu、Zn、Cd、Pb、As和Hg的年均含量分别为15.37 mg/kg、63.97 mg/kg、0.175 mg/kg、18.32 mg/kg、8.05 mg/kg和0.097 mg/kg。海水中综合污染指数小于1,海水未受到重金属的污染;沉积物综合污染指数大于10,呈现较高污染状况,主要是由海水养殖和船舶运输造成的。通过潜在生态风险指数评价表明,该海域表层沉积物中重金属对海洋生态系统的潜在生态风险属于中等水平,重金属的危害大小顺序是Hg﹥Cd﹥As﹥Cu﹥Pb﹥Zn。In order to evaluate the content and distribution of heavy metals of seawater and sediments in coastal waters, a case study has been carried out in Xincun Lagoon. In current study, the concentrations of heavy metals, including cadmium (Cd), lead (Pb), arsenic (As), copper (Cu), mercury (Hg) and zinc (Zn), from seawater and surface sediment have been analyzed. Subsequently, the pollution and potential ecological risk of heavy metals in seawater and surface sediments have been assessed by methodologies of comprehensive pollution index method and potential ecological risk index, respectively. The results showed that the concentrations of Cd, Pb, As, Cu, and Zn in seawater ranged from 0 to 0.58 μg/L, 0 to 3.85 μg/L, 0.6 to 4.15 μg/L, 0.55 to 4.7 μg/L and 0 to 48 p.g/L, respectively. The annual average concentrations of listed heavy metals were 0.073 μg/L, 0.87 p-g/L, 1.67 μg/L, 1.90 μg/L, and 14.49 μg/L, respectively. However, the content of Hg in seawater was not detected. Moreover, the annual average concentrations of Cd, Zn, Cd, Pb, As and Hg in surface sediments were 15.37 mg/kg, 63.97 mg/kg, 0.175 mg/kg, 18.32 mg/kg, 8.05 mg/kg, and 0.097 mg/kg, respectively. It suggested that the sea water was not polluted by heavy metals as the results of comprehensive pollution index was less than 1. However, the heavy metals surface sediments was at a relatively high pollution status because the comprehensive pollution index was more than 10, which was probably caused by mariculture and shipping. Furthermore, the results showed that the potential ecological risk of heavy metals in the surface sediments was medium level, and the potential risks indexes of heavy metals from high to low were listed as Hg, Cd, As, Cu, Pb and Zn.
